Uzushio, nestled along the scenic shores of Awaji Island in Hyogo Prefecture, is more than a roadside station—it’s a celebration of local heritage, innovation, and the rhythm of nature. Located just minutes from the Awaji South Interchange, this revitalized destination invites travelers to experience the island’s bounty through its vibrant mix of food, culture, and panoramic views. With its new "Uzushio Vision" digital display and the iconic 360° panoramic observation deck, visitors are greeted with ever-changing stories of the region’s seasons, people, and landscapes.
At the heart of Uzushio lies the award-winning Awaji Island Burger, a culinary ambassador that has earned national acclaim, including first and second place in the National Local Burger Grand Prix. From the legendary Onion Beef Burger to the richly layered Onion Gratin Burger, each creation highlights Awaji’s famed onions, fresh seafood, and premium beef. Complementing these standout dishes are seasonal specialties, gourmet soft serve made with local milk and citrus, and a diverse selection of regional products at the Uzunokuni Shop. Facilities & Amenities
Relax and recharge with spacious restrooms, ample parking, and scenic viewing areas at Uzushio roadside station.
Parking
Free parking for 102 vehicles (including 4 disabled parking spaces).
Near the roadside station
Toilet
Available 24 hours, even outside operating hours.
Near the roadside station
Wi-Fi
Available throughout the facility.
Throughout the roadside station
Information Center
Located at the facility's front desk, providing assistance and information about the roadside station and surrounding area.
Front desk of the roadside station
Play Area
Outdoor play and relaxation areas including the Dog Run, which is accessible outside operating hours.
Outside the facility
EV Charging Station
Available for electric vehicles.
Near the roadside station
ATM
Available on-site for cash withdrawal.
Inside the roadside station
Pet Area
Pets are not allowed inside the facility, but takeout food can be enjoyed with pets in the outdoor terrace area.
Outdoor terrace area
Insider Tips
Plan your visit around peak seasons and use shuttle services to avoid traffic—locals know the best times to explore.
- Best Arrival Time: Visit between 9:00 AM and 9:30 AM on weekdays to secure a seat at the あわじ島バーガー 淡路島オニオンキッチン 本店 before the lunch rush begins, as the shop sees high demand after 10:00 AM.
- Hidden Gems: Look for the あわじ島玉ねぎ丸ごとおでん (whole onion stew) at the あわじ島バーガー 淡路島オニオンキッチン 本店—it’s a limited-time, exclusive menu item made with a whole fresh onion and fried onion, available only during lunch hours.
- Weekend Special: On weekends, visit the 囲炉裏食堂うずしお (fire pit restaurant) between 10:30 AM and 12:00 PM to order the うずの幸定食 (local seafood set), which includes grilled seasonal fish and a choice of side dishes featuring fresh local ingredients like Awa Island onions and Awaji beef.
- Best Value Combo: Order the あわじ島オニオンビーフバーガー (Awa Island Onion Beef Burger) with the あわじ島ミルクソフト (Awa Island milk soft serve) for a full-flavored, budget-friendly combo priced at 1,350 yen (tax included), available at the あわじ島ミルクスタンド+(プラス).
- Unique Experience: Visit the 絶景展望360°(サンロクマル) (360° panoramic view) at exactly 12:00 PM to catch the midday light reflection off the Naruto Strait, which enhances the visibility of the Naruto whirlpools—best viewed during the peak season from April to October.
- Exclusive Product: Purchase the あわじ島ニューニューニューソフト (Awa Island New New New Soft) at the あわじ島ミルクスタンド+(プラス) only during the summer months—this limited-time flavor combines Awa Island yogurt “Mikoto” with Awa Island milk soft serve and is not available at the Uzuno Koji branch.
- Best Photo Spot: Take a photo at the 灯台ひろば (Lighthouse Plaza) during golden hour (just before sunset) to capture the iconic view of the Naruto Bridge with the sun setting behind it, especially during the summer when the lighting enhances the bridge’s silhouette.
Best Time to Visit
Spring (March-May): Fresh bamboo shoots and seasonal vegetables peak in spring, with the Fujinotana Tunnel blooming in late April.
Summer (June-August): The seaside setting offers cool relief, with fresh fish and seasonal soft-serve available through August.
Autumn (September-November): The uzu-shi-o vision features autumn foliage, and the Fujinotana Tunnel blooms with purple flowers in early October.
Winter (December-February): Warm soups and baked goods are available, with the 360° panoramic view especially scenic during winter clear days.
